SUBJECT: MFA REQUESTS SMALLPOX/ANTHRAX VACCINES 
 
REF: A. 02 STATE 256691 
     ΒΆB. 02 STATE 256701 
 
 
(U) Classified by DCM Robert Deutsch for reasons 1.5 (B) and 
(D) 
 
 
(C) Polmiloff delivered refs A and B to MFA Iraq desk officer 
Ferhat Alkan on December 13 and subsequently learned that the 
information had been passed to MFA's International Political 
Organizations Department.  Meeting with Econoff on February 
4, Feza Ozturk, MFA Department Head for International 
Political Organizations, provided the GOT's response to ref B 
offer of access to U.S. smallpox and anthrax vaccines. 
Ozturk stated that the GOT would like to receive vaccines for 
30,000 persons for smallpox and 70,000 persons for anthrax. 
The GOT would dedicate vaccine for 20,000 military personnel 
for both smallpox and anthrax from these amounts, and would 
also be interested in receiving a civilian/military expert 
team to discuss the vaccines.  Ozturk also requested 
confirmation that there would be no charge to Turkey for the 
vaccines.
